A Hornby R2714 OO gauge British Railways Standard Class 4 4-6-0 steam locomotive and tender number 75005 in lined black livery with the early post-nationalisation BR crest on the tender sides.  


The locomotive is well detailed and features sprung buffers, lamp irons, wire handrails, distinctive Riddles design features, lots of copper effect exterior pipework,  tender ladder, a very highly detailed cab interior and a shed code on the smoke box door (89D - Oswestry).
